BancFirst Trust & Investment Management purchased a new stake in Broadcom Inc. (NASDAQ:AVGO – Free Report) in the second qu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The firm purchased 1,200 shares of the semiconductor manufacturer’s stock, valued at approximately $323,000. Broadcom makes up approximately 0.1% of BancFirst Trust & Investment Management’s holdings, making the stock its 29th largest position.

Broadcom Company Profile
Broadcom Inc designs, develops, and supplies various semiconductor devices with a focus on complex digital and mixed signal complementary metal oxide semiconductor based devices and analog III-V based products wor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Semiconductor Solutions and Infrastructure Software.
